Abstract

The invention discloses a purification process of mineral slag by a chlorination process. The process comprises the following steps: carrying out low-temperature chlorination and recovering a solid product after reaction through a cyclone separation device; recovering a gaseous product through a first dust collector; carrying out high-temperature chlorination and recovering the gaseous product after reaction through a condenser; and settling the solid product after reaction through a second dust collector to form dust collecting slag. According to the process disclosed by the invention, elements in associated lean ores can be effectively separated to obtain a required corresponding product, so that the utilization mode of lean ore resources is enriched. According to the process disclosed by the invention, a chromium trichloride product of an industrial grade can be obtained, so that a problem of treating chromium slag after extraction of resources is avoided.

Description

technical field

[0001] The invention relates to the field of chemical smelting of minerals, in particular to a chlorination purification process of slag. Background technique

[0002] At present, there is a new situation in the development of vanadium and titanium resources in the Panxi area, that is, the resource distribution in the Hongge ore veins has changed greatly from the previous veins, and the most prominent is that the chromium content has increased greatly. After mining, the slag still contains available vanadium, chromium, iron and titanium resources. If the ironmaking process is directly used, the vanadium, titanium and chromium resources will not be utilized, and the blast furnace slag will contain a relatively high concentration of chromium Oxides cannot be stacked directly, which will greatly increase the cost of post-processing.
